I have a 1992 500e with beautiful Cream Beige interior. No rips, etc, and though the seats aren't new, they are in great shape.
I use my car as a daily driver, and I wear Jeans pretty much every day.
At first, I thought I was just getting my seat bottoms dirty somehow, but upon closer inspection, it seems that blue jeans dye "seeps" into light colored leather, and this is a standard problem.
So I have three questions:
1.) Is there a treatment to prevent this some how?
2.) What's the best way to suck the blue stain OUT?
3.) Seat covers? Sheepskin? I looked around on the forum, and I see that Rams Heads are nice, but 800.00 for a set is a little much. I can get new leather from GAHH for 1700....
Thoughts?
